Tool #1 – Statcast Radar

Here is the deal: Statcast pulls every launch angle, exit velocity, and spin rate from MLB’s sensor suite. You can slice the data by player, venue, even pitcher‑vs‑batter matchup. A single query reveals that a left‑handed slugger’s home‑run rate spikes 22% on indoor fields. The insight? Bet the “indoors” prop and watch the edge widen.

Tool #4 – Excel + Power Query

Don’t scoff at spreadsheets. Pair Excel with Power Query, and you’ve got a mini‑ETL engine that drags raw CSVs from MLB’s open data portal, cleans them, and builds pivot tables faster than a coffee‑break. The trick is to set a macro that recalculates every 15 minutes—so you’re always betting on fresh numbers.

Tool #5 – Python Scraper + Betfair API

If you’re comfortable with code, a Python script can scrape player prop lines from multiple sportsbooks, compare them, and auto‑place bets through the Betfair API when a price discrepancy breaches your threshold. The code base is a few hundred lines, but the payoff can be exponential.
